Abstract

Permutation codes have been shown to be useful in power line communications, block ciphers, and multilevel flash memory models. Construction of such codes is extremely difficult. In fact, the only general lower bound known is the Gilbert-Varshamov type bound. In this paper, we establish a connection between permutation codes and independent sets in certain graphs. Using the connection, we improve the Gilbert-Varshamov bound asymptotically by a factor log(n), when the code lengthngoes to infinity.
